What is the SI unit for force which is equal to kg?

There is no force that is equal to 1 kg, because the 'kg' is a unit of mass, not force.If a certain force pushing on a 1 kg mass accelerates that mass at the rate of(1 meter per second) every second, then that force is called "1 newton', andthat's the SI unit of force.

Can the force of gravity on a 1 kg mass ever be more than on a 2 kg mass?

Not if they're in the same place, or simply on the same planet. But if the 1 kg is on the Earth and the 2 kg is on the moon, then the force of gravity on the 1 kg is 9.8 newtons (2.205 pounds), and the force of gravity on the 2 kg is only 3.2 newtons (0.730 pound). And if the 1 kg is on ANY planet, and the 2 kg is in space, then the force of gravity on the 1 kg is something, and the force of gravity on the 2 kg is approximately zero.
